Overview

Andhra Pradesh isthe eighth largest state in India. It is one of the historical region, which offers the gloriesbeaches, stunning hills, ancient caves, rich wildlife, dense forests and spectacular temples. You can feel the essence of the history, culture and traditions of this region while exploring the various monuments. ‘Andhra Pradesh Buddhist Tour’ is the well-designed package which gives you the chance to explore the major destination of the region. During this tour you will explore Hyderabad Renowned as the City of Nawabs, Itis culturally rich city of India. It is the capital of Andhra Pradesh and Telangana. You will visit Nagarjunkonda. It is a historical Buddhist town, renowned for its Buddhist temple remains and museum. The town is situated near NagarjunaSagar in Guntur district in Andhra Pradesh.You will also visit Warangal. It is considered one of the heritage cities and the second-fastest growing city in Telangana state. This city offers a wealth of architecture and exquisite sculptures, which reflects the richness of this town. Apart from this you will get an opportunity to explore the two major Buddhist places Vijaywada. It is also known as "The Business Capital of Andhra Pradesh", located on the banks of the Krishna River in Andhra Pradesh and Amravati, which is situated on the banks of Krishna River in Andhra Pradesh. It was once the capital of first Andhra dynasty, the satvahanas and during Buddhism golden era, dated back to 2nd century BCE.

Apart from this you will also explore Visakhapatnam, which is also known as Vizag, it is the second largest city in Andhra Pradesh. Located on the Eastern Ghats, it overlooks the Bay of Bangal, and bound by hills. Its harbour became a port after it was colonised by the Dutch and later the British. It is the major commercial city, which is the home to the oldest shipyard and the only natural harbour on the east coast of India. The city is also the headquarters for Eastern Naval Command of the Indian Navy. The duration of the tour is 06 nights and 07 days.
